 Self-taught painter born in Switzerland (1964)
A painter for grand-father, unfortunately he died before my birth. He gave me the idea and the desire to paint. It was 14 years ago. I didn't go to any important school; I just paint with intuition. Georgia O'Keefe's painting showed me that I wanted to paint flowers
and most precisely, roses.
I used several techniques: oil, watercolour and more recently acryl, but I prefer
oil. I like to add some paper or sand in my pictures.
